The Canadian dollar weakened against the greenback on Tuesday, and the yield on benchmark government debt climbed. The loonie was trading 0.5% lower at C$1.373 to the greenback, or 72.83 U.S. cents, after trading in a range of 1.3659 to 1.3736. Canadian government 10-year bond yields rose 4 basis points to 3.801%. The yield on similar U.S. government benchmark debt rose to 4.6633%. U.S. June crude futures rose 32 cents to $82.95 a barrel on Tuesday.
